Bonus Math

Let us break down how bonuses work with a real example. Suppose the casino offers a 100% match bonus up to £100 on your first deposit. You deposit £50. The casino gives you another £50 in bonus funds, so you have £100 total to play with. However, the bonus comes with a wagering requirement, say 35 times the bonus amount. That means you must wager 35 × £50 = £1,750 before you can withdraw any winnings from the bonus.

If the game you are playing contributes to wagering at different rates, the actual amount changes. For instance, slots typically contribute 100%, but table games might contribute only 10%. If you play a game with 10% contribution, each £1 bet adds only £0.10 toward your wagering. To meet the requirement, you would need to wager £1,750 / 0.10 = £17,500 in that game. Always check the contribution rates in the terms.

Another important number is the maximum bet while playing with bonus funds. Often, it is capped at £5 per spin or hand. If you bet more than the cap, the casino may void your bonus. So, keep your bets within the limit.

Finally, consider the time limit. Most bonuses must be wagered within 30 days. If you fail to meet the requirement in time, the bonus and any winnings from it will be forfeited. Bankroll management is key: budget your deposit, decide how many spins you can afford, and stick to your plan.

Is It Safe?

When you use the casino lab login, you are entering a platform that should protect your personal and financial data. The first thing to check is the license. A reputable casino holds a license from a recognized authority, such as the UK Gambling Commission or the Malta Gaming Authority. The license number is usually displayed in the footer of the website.

Next, look for SSL encryption. The site should use HTTPS, which means data you send is encrypted. You can see a padlock icon in the address bar. Your password and payment details are transmitted securely.

Important: If the casino operates under a Curacao license, be aware that winnings may be subject to local income tax in some countries. Unlike UK or Malta licensed casinos, Curacao does not necessarily withhold taxes, so you might have to declare your winnings yourself. Always check your local laws.

Responsible gambling tools are a sign of safety. Features like deposit limits, loss limits, and self-exclusion options show that the casino cares about player wellbeing. You should have access to these from your account settings or the support team.
